Does anyone have a simple standalone demo or example that puts up a jqGrid and fills it with some contrived data?
I've been trying to hack on the example.html provided in the 3.5 beta demo, but the file won't run from my hard drive as it depends on too many things from the trirand server.
(I'm trying to get a simple jqGrid showing from my Django app but I'd like to work out the presentation - so I have something to look at - before I figure out how to load actual data.)

If you go the the 3.5 online demos at
http://www.trirand.com/jqgrid3.....qgrid.html
..and in the first section, Loading Data, go to the last of those - Array Data. That uses a local array to load the data so you can use that method as a basis for testing layout etc. (I believe you need to remove the gridimgpath line though as that is no longer used in the latest version .... but don't quote me on that)
